由于升级了 ovirt 自托管引擎,我将集群置于 中global maintenance mode
。我不知道shutdown -r now
在引擎 VM 内发出命令实际上不会重新启动引擎,而只会使其关闭。阅读后发动机故障排除指南我现在再次明白了更多。
由于未知原因,引擎运行所在节点的 root 密码未知。因此我无法通过 shell 或 web 界面进入该节点。
那么...如果我通过发出来停用能够运行引擎的集群的另一个节点上的全局维护模式hosted-engine --set-maintenance --mode=none
,这会触发托管引擎的重新启动吗?
集群正在运行 ovirt 4.1.9。
答案1
回答我自己的问题:是的,这就是将要发生的事情。当 ovirt 集群处于运行状态global ha maintenance mode
并且托管引擎 vm 已关闭时,可以通过在能够运行托管引擎的节点上发出此命令来重新启动它。
# hosted-engine --set-maintenance --mode=none
让系统花几分钟来收集其状态。然后引擎应该会再次启动。